WAC 296-849-11070









Notification.









You must:
• Provide written notification of exposure monitoring results to the employees represented by your exposure evaluation within five business days after the monitoring results become known to you.
– In addition, when employee exposure monitoring results are above a permissible exposure limit (PEL), provide written notification of all of the following within fifteen business days after these exposure monitoring results become known to you:
■ Corrective actions being taken and a schedule for completion;
AND
■ Any reason why exposures cannot be lowered to below the PELs for benzene.

Note:
• You can notify employees either individually or post the notifications in areas readily accessible to affected employees.

 
• Posted notification may need specific information that allows affected employees to determine which monitoring results apply to them.

 
• Notification may be in any written form, such as handwritten or e-mail.

 
• Notification may be limited to the required information, such as exposure monitoring results.

 
• When notifying employees about corrective actions, your notification may refer them to a separate document that's available and provides the required information.

[Statutory Authority: RCW 49.17.010, 49.17.040, 49.17.050, 49.17.060. WSR 05-01-172, § 296-849-11070, filed 12/21/04, effective 3/1/05.]
